如何在MySQL中實(shí)現(xiàn)短信發(fā)送時(shí)的換行效果??
,來(lái)實(shí)現(xiàn)換行。當(dāng)你需要在發(fā)送的短信內(nèi)容中插入換行時(shí),只需在相應(yīng)的位置添加,即可。,,``sql,UPDATE your_table SET message_column = CONCAT(message_column, ',', '新的一行內(nèi)容');,``,,這樣,在發(fā)送短信時(shí),短信內(nèi)容就會(huì)按照換行符進(jìn)行換行顯示。在發(fā)送短信時(shí)實(shí)現(xiàn)換行的操作通常需要依據(jù)所使用的短信API和平臺(tái)的規(guī)范,具體到MySQL環(huán)境中,處理數(shù)據(jù)時(shí)通常會(huì)將換行符作為特殊字符處理,以下是詳細(xì)的操作方法和注意事項(xiàng),通過(guò)小標(biāo)題和單元表格形式進(jìn)行說(shuō)明:

總體
當(dāng)需要在短信內(nèi)容中實(shí)現(xiàn)換行效果時(shí),一種常見(jiàn)的做法是在字符串中添加特定的換行符,在不同的系統(tǒng)和環(huán)境中,這些換行符可能有所不同,但通常使用的是`
(新?lián)Q行符)、\r`(回車符)或者二者的組合。
詳細(xì)方法
1. 確定換行符

Linux/Unix系統(tǒng):通常使用`
`作為換行符。
Windows系統(tǒng):使用`\r
`作為換行符。
舊式Mac系統(tǒng):使用\r作為換行符。

2. 拼接短信內(nèi)容
使用程序語(yǔ)言的字符串拼接功能,按照上述換行標(biāo)準(zhǔn)將不同部分的內(nèi)容連接起來(lái),若想在“短信內(nèi)容A”和“短信內(nèi)容B”之間換行,可以將其拼接為`A + '
' + B`。
3. API調(diào)用
將拼接好的字符串作為參數(shù)傳遞給發(fā)送短信的API或函數(shù)調(diào)用,確保API支持在消息體中傳遞換行符,并能夠正確解析這些符號(hào)以實(shí)現(xiàn)換行效果。
注意事項(xiàng)
API兼容性:不是所有的短信API都支持通過(guò)添加換行符來(lái)實(shí)現(xiàn)短信內(nèi)容的換行,在使用前,最好查閱相關(guān)API的文檔或咨詢技術(shù)支持。
字符轉(zhuǎn)義問(wèn)題:在某些情況下,直接在字符串中添加`
可能不會(huì)按預(yù)期工作,因?yàn)榉葱备?/code>\可能是轉(zhuǎn)義字符,根據(jù)編程語(yǔ)言的不同,可能需要使用雙反斜杠\\`或者原始字符串前綴來(lái)確保換行符被正確處理。
相關(guān)問(wèn)題與解答
Q1: 如果短信API不支持標(biāo)準(zhǔn)的換行符怎么辦?
A1: 可以嘗試使用API提供的特定標(biāo)記或格式來(lái)實(shí)現(xiàn)換行,例如一些平臺(tái)可能允許使用特定的格式化代碼,如果這種方法也不可行,那么可能需要(本文來(lái)源:WWW.KengnIAO.cOM)尋找其他支持換行的短信發(fā)送服務(wù)。
Q2: 如何處理來(lái)自MySQL數(shù)據(jù)庫(kù)的字段值中的換行符?
A2: 在MySQL數(shù)據(jù)庫(kù)中,換行符通常存儲(chǔ)為`
`,從數(shù)據(jù)庫(kù)讀取這樣的字段并在短信中使用之前,需要確保在應(yīng)用程序中正確地處理這個(gè)轉(zhuǎn)義序列,避免它被解釋為普通文本而不是換行符。
在發(fā)送短信時(shí)實(shí)現(xiàn)換行,關(guān)鍵在于正確地拼接包含換行符的字符串,并且確保短信API支持這種格式,要注意在處理來(lái)自數(shù)據(jù)庫(kù)的數(shù)據(jù)時(shí)保持對(duì)換行符的正確處理。
